Abstract

The utility model discloses an improved diesel generator set gantry crane which comprises a cross beam and a lifting assembly, wherein two sides of the bottom end of the cross beam are fixedly provided with vertical beams, the bottom ends of the two vertical beams are fixedly connected with stabilizing plates, the tops of the corresponding sides of the two vertical beams are fixedly connected with connecting sliding rods, the lifting assembly comprises a fixed shell, a second forward and reverse rotating motor, a second gear, a fixed plate and a wire wheel, the fixed shell is fixedly arranged at the bottom end of a sliding rod sleeve, and the second forward and reverse rotating motor is fixedly arranged in the fixed shell, and the improved diesel generator set gantry crane has the beneficial effects that: the shell is driven to move under the action of the rack, the sliding rod sleeve is driven to move under the matching of the sliding rail and the sliding block, and the fixed shell correspondingly moves, so that the position of the diesel generating set is adjusted; the four pulleys can facilitate the movement of the gantry crane; four bracing can fix two perpendicular roof beams to make its stability more at the during operation.

Technical Field
The utility model relates to a gantry crane, in particular to an improved diesel generator set gantry crane, and belongs to the technical field of gantry cranes.
Background
At present, diesel generator sets in the market are widely used as standby or main power supplies, and in order to bring more convenience to the carrying process, a gantry crane is designed for a plurality of silent diesel generator sets, and top lifting is adopted. Most of existing gantry cranes can only lift a diesel generator set, and when the diesel generator set is lifted from the top, the weight of the diesel generator set is too heavy, the position of the diesel generator set needs to be adjusted manually, time and labor are wasted, and the gantry cranes are very troublesome to use.

Referring to fig. 1-4, the utility model provides an improved diesel generator set gantry crane, which comprises a cross beam 1 and a lifting assembly 4, wherein two sides of the bottom end of the cross beam 1 are both fixedly provided with vertical beams 2, the bottom ends of the two vertical beams 2 are both fixedly connected with stabilizing plates 5, the tops of the corresponding sides of the two vertical beams 2 are fixedly connected with connecting slide bars 3, the surfaces of the connecting slide bars 3 are slidably connected with slide bar sleeves 15, the top ends of the slide bar sleeves 15 are fixedly connected with connecting rods 14, the bottom end inside the cross beam 1 is fixedly provided with slide rails 8, the inside of the slide rails 8 is slidably connected with slide blocks 13, the top ends of the connecting rods 14 are fixedly connected with the bottom ends of the slide blocks 13, the top ends of the slide blocks 13 are fixedly connected with a shell 9, the inside of the shell 9 is fixedly provided with a first forward and reverse rotation motor 10, the output end of the first forward and reverse rotation motor 10 is fixedly provided with a first gear 11, the lifting assembly 4 comprises a fixed shell 41, Second positive and negative motor 42, second gear 43, fixed plate 45 and line wheel 46, the fixed bottom that sets up at slide bar sleeve 15 of set casing 41, second positive and negative motor 42 fixed mounting is in the inside of set casing 41, the output fixedly connected with second gear 43 of second positive and negative motor 42, fixed plate 45 is fixed to be set up the one side in the inside bottom of set casing 41, the top of fixed plate 45 is rotated and is connected with the bull stick, the one end of bull stick is rotated with the middle part of set casing 41 one side inner wall and is connected, the fixed surface of bull stick is connected with line wheel 46.
Preferably, a steel rope is fixedly arranged inside the wire wheel 46, and the bottom end of the steel rope can be connected with a lifting hook, so that the diesel generator set is lifted; the other end of the rotating rod is fixedly connected with a third gear 44, the third gear 44 is meshed with a second gear 43, and a wire wheel 46 can be driven to rotate under the rotation of a second forward and reverse rotating motor 42; pulleys 6 are fixedly arranged on two sides of the bottom ends of the two stabilizing plates 5, and the four pulleys 6 can facilitate the movement of the gantry crane; the bottom parts of the two sides of the two vertical beams 2 are fixedly connected with inclined struts 7, the bottom ends of the four inclined struts 7 are respectively and fixedly connected with the two sides of the top ends of the two stabilizing plates 5, and the four inclined struts 7 can fix the two vertical beams 2, so that the two vertical beams are more stable during working; a rack 12 is fixedly arranged on one side of the bottom end in the beam 1, a first gear 11 is meshed with the rack 12, a first forward and reverse rotating motor 10 can drive the first gear 11 to rotate, the shell 9 is driven to move under the action of the rack 12, and a sliding rod sleeve 15 is driven to move under the matching of a sliding rail 8 and a sliding block 13, so that the position of the fixed shell 41 is adjusted; the middle part of one of them perpendicular roof beam 2 one side is fixed and is equipped with flush mounting plate of switch, flush mounting plate's fixed surface is equipped with first control switch and second control switch, and first positive reverse motor 10 and second positive reverse motor 42 are respectively through first control switch and second control switch and power electric connection, and flush mounting plate of switch can the person of facilitating the use operate this portal crane, uses manpower sparingly.
When the improved diesel generator set gantry crane is used, firstly, the bottom end of a steel rope is connected with a lifting hook to hoist the diesel generator set, then, a second forward and reverse rotating motor 42 is started through a second control switch on a switch panel, a second gear 43 is driven to rotate under the rotation of the second forward and reverse rotating motor 42, a wire wheel 46 is driven to rotate under the cooperation of a third gear 44, so that the diesel generator set is lifted, then, a first forward and reverse rotating motor 10 is controlled through a first control switch, the first forward and reverse rotating motor 10 drives a first gear 11 to rotate, a shell 9 is driven to move under the action of a rack 12, a sliding rod sleeve 15 is driven to move under the cooperation of a sliding rail 8 and a sliding block 13, and a fixed shell 41 correspondingly moves, so that the position of the diesel generator set is adjusted, four braces 7 may secure two vertical beams 2, making them more stable in operation.
